5. Challenges and Drawbacks:
While online poker brings numerous benefits, it is not without its difficulties. One of the significant downsides may be the possibility fraudulent activities, including collusion and processor chip dumping, where players cheat to achieve an unfair benefit. But reputable internet poker platforms use powerful security actions and random number generators to thwart these types of behavior. Additionally, some people could find the lack of real cues and communications which can be section of live poker games a disadvantage, as it can be more difficult to learn opponents and use mental techniques on line.
